The 567 Center for Renewal dreams of a vibrant downtown Macon filled with successful businesses and creative professionals, a downtown filled with the arts and enjoyed by people of all ages from all places. The Center serves as a collaborative community space where entrepreneurs, artists, and musicians bring creative life to downtown Macon through events, classes, and business development. For the last six years, The 567 Center has been a pillar of quality life in downtown Macon and a vibrant catalyst for community strength and economic development.

What started as a venue for concerts and art exhibits evolved to offer so much more: weekly art classes, workspace for more than twenty businesses, professional workshops, lunchtime dance parties, spoken-word performances, film festivals, and literary conferences. These programs have brought hundreds of people to downtown Macon and reshaped people’s ideas of what downtown Macon is and could be.

The heart of what we do has always been the arts, because art is a powerful vehicle for growth. Arts events and experiences can create jobs, attract tourism dollars, and give people a stronger connection to Macon. Some of our 2016 accomplishments follow:

  •  We attracted 500-plus people to downtown Macon with arts events at The 567.

  • More than one-third of those who attended our art classes lived outside of Macon. People came from as far as Milledgeville and Americus for our classes.

  • We gave more than thirty artists an opportunity to share their talents and earn income by either teaching classes or exhibiting their work at The 567. 

  • We provided guidance and assistance for the Lost Keys Literary Festival, which brought writers from across the country to Macon for its second year.

In 2016 we also purchased a new building and moved from Cherry Street to First Street. We completed many renovations and repairs when we moved, but there is still much work left to do in our new space. In addition to these building improvements, goals for our organization include increasing the quantity and diversity of our programs and becoming more financially sustainable.

The 567 Center is funded mainly by income from our art classes and by the generous support of our community.
